By this Writ Petition, under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, Petitioner is seeking direction against Respondent no.1 to give the appointment to the Petitioner on compassionate ground.

3.

It is the case of the Petitioner that Petitioner's father was working with Respondent no.1 who died on 18.01.1994. At that time, Petitioner and her brother were minors and hence, his uncle Rajendra Dada Khandale was appointed on Mohite 1/2

6 wp1069-19.odt compassionate ground. He submits that his uncle also expired on 21.05.2016. Thereafter, his uncle's wife i.e. Respondent no.5 made Application for appointment on compassionate ground and that was allowed. He submits that it is mandatory as per the G.R. dated 21.09.2017 for the person who appointed on compassionate ground to maintain the legal heirs of the deceased. He submits that Respondent no.5 is not maintaining the family of deceased employee. Therefore, the Petitioner fled the present petition. 4.

When this Court declined to entertain the present Writ Petition on the ground that the Petitioner has not made prayers to cancel the appointment of Respondent no.5 and other consequential reliefs, the learned counsel for the Petitioner submits that Petitioner may be permitted to withdraw the Writ Petition with liberty to fle afresh for same cause of action. To that effect, he has given in writing. Same is taken on record and marked 'X' for identifcation. Same is accepted.

5.

Writ Petition stands disposed of as withdrawn with liberty as prayed.

6.

All contention of both the parties are kept open. 7.

No order as to costs.
